What makes a song work on a music box

Before the lists, one quick principle: a music box plays a single, delicate melody line, not a full production. So the songs that sound most beautiful are the ones with strong, clear melodies, the kind you can hum without the words. Ballads, lullabies, film themes, and classic love songs tend to shine. Beat-driven tracks can still be arranged, but songs carried by melody translate best.

Most requested songs for weddings and anniversaries

Couples often choose their first-dance song or a track that defined their relationship. Popular and well-suited choices include:

  • “Can’t Help Falling in Love”, Elvis Presley
  • “Perfect”, Ed Sheeran
  • “A Thousand Years”, Christina Perri
  • “All of Me”, John Legend
  • “La Vie en Rose”, Édith Piaf
  • “At Last”, Etta James
  • “Your Song”, Elton John
  • “Marry Me”, Train

These carry strong melodies and deep romantic association, which makes them land on an anniversary box wound up year after year.

Most requested songs for new babies and christenings

For a new baby, a christening, or a nursery keepsake, gentle melodies fit best:

  • “Brahms’ Lullaby”
  • “Twinkle, Twinkle, Little Star”
  • “You Are My Sunshine”
  • “Somewhere Over the Rainbow”
  • “Beautiful Boy”, John Lennon
  • “Isn’t She Lovely”, Stevie Wonder

Soft, simple, and soothing, exactly what a music box does best, and what a child can grow up with.
